[PATCH v1.0.6] Tutorial and Combat Tempo Improvements

Hello. This update improves the tutorial opening hand, combat tempo, card text display, and pause screen, while also fixing several localization and animation issues.

[Tutorial Improvements] - Fixed the opening tutorial hand for each starter. - Core starter cards should now appear more reliably during tutorial battles.

[Combat Tempo Improvements] - Reduced the delay between enemy AI actions. - Separated the delay for the first enemy action and follow-up actions so enemy turns flow more quickly.

[Card Text Improvements] - Hand cards during battle now show only the core effect text. - Keyword help text is now separated and remains available in the card detail panel and the card upgrade/removal screens. - Adjusted the way descriptions and cost information are displayed in the card upgrade/removal screens.

[Pause Screen Improvements] - The pause screen now displays current run information. - You can now check your starter, current location, turn count, and playtime from the pause screen. - Playtime no longer increases while the game is paused.

[Animation Fix] - Fixed an issue where the black Knight attack animation faced the wrong direction.

[Localization Fixes] - Added missing localization keys for some logs, card effects, events, and pause UI text.
